Kano deputy governor appointment sees Murtala Sule Garo selected by Governor Abba Yusuf based on experience and confirmed by the State Assembly
Kano State Governor, Abba Kabir Yusuf, has explained the appointment of Murtala Sule Garo as the new deputy governor, stating that the decision was based on experience, competence, and commitment to development.

The governor made the remarks during the 39th Executive Council meeting held at the Government House in Kano, according to a statement issued by his spokesperson, Mustapha Muhammad.
Yusuf said several candidates were considered before Garo was selected, adding that the choice was guided by performance records and the ability to support the administration’s development agenda.
He said the government required a deputy governor who could effectively complement ongoing efforts to drive progress across the state.
The nomination followed the resignation of former deputy governor Aminu Abdulsalam Gwarzo, after which Garo’s name was forwarded to the Kano State House of Assembly.
Lawmakers subsequently screened and confirmed the nomination within a short period.
Governor Yusuf commended the State Assembly, led by Speaker Jibril Ismail Falgore, for its swift consideration and approval of the appointment.
He stated that Garo would be sworn in soon and urged residents to support him in discharging his responsibilities.
During the same meeting, the governor congratulated the new Head of Service, Hajiya Bilkisu Shehu Maimota, describing her as experienced and capable based on her previous service records.

He called on civil servants and stakeholders across the state to cooperate with her in strengthening public administration.
